Really loud echoing as the host that only I can hear... help

I have been using Zoom for 1 on 1 meetings with my students for the last 2 years on my all in 1 PC desktop. I do not have external speakers nor an external mic. There is no one else in my office so no other computers or speakers near me. I use the original sound for musicians and no noise cancelations since I need to make sure we both can hear softer sounds such as /k/ and /th/. Everything has been smooth up until a few weeks ago when my voice started echoing like crazy. My students can't hear it on their end, and they don't echo, only I do ( on my computer only). I have updated drivers, used head phones, played around with mic and speaker volume , as well as played around with some of the zoom sound options... nothing has helped....... any suggestions?
